The Disaster Recovery Unit is a new section within the Division of Administration's Office of Community Development created by the Commissioner of Administration to administer the CDBG Disaster Recovery funds, amounting to $10.4 billion, allocated to Louisiana after Hurricanes Katrina and Rita. The Disaster Recovery Unit and the Louisiana Recovery Authority are tasked with developing programs through which to administer these funds, including The Road Home program.

Rebuild Louisiana: Investments in Infrastructure

www.rebuild.la.gov is a website that provides searchable, detailed information about rebuilding projects throughout storm impacted South Louisiana that are funded by FEMA Public Assistance and Disaster Community Development Block Grant.
